Hello good sirs,

Ive just started posting again the last few days and unfortunately all my pictures from the past i lost 2 years ago. These mushroom pics are the only ones left of that era and represent a production run in 2005. I'm not going to get into too much detail and will just present the pics sort of as-is and then if anyone has any specific questions I'll be glad to answer. This was just before upgrading to a rather large autoclave and vacuum bag system which vastly increased production. Within a few months the regional market crashed from the glut and soon after the property i was renting (hehe) was sold and I havent returned to a full on production run. So basically these pics consist of an operation that yielded an average of 10lbs per month over approx. 1 yr. I used a liquid inoculant and a brown rice/rye flour and vermiculite medium. Losses from contamination averaged 3%, with lowest being 1.4%. The exact number escapes me now but I had more than 1200 frickin bernardin jars! Surprisingly not that much labour, i had a helper with me and it required about 10-15 hrs each per week on average which was why i was always pushing for the big bad autoclave. Running that many jars in 6 pressure cookers on 2 stoves was a bastard, to be sure.

Hehe, hey guys! I wasn't expecting any replies so quickly! You can see in the shot of the tubs that they're not all the same in terms of holes and tubes. This is because i was experimenting for the optimal distribution. I used the tubes to prevent contamination by putting alcohol soaked cotton swabs in them as a line of defense. I was playing around with ventilation because you can see in some of the pics those little wierd mutant buttons. It was hard to pin down and i never quite did find the true reason but i determined it had something to do with ventilation, possibly an increased level of carbon dioxide or monoxide. Those buttons were absolutely ridiculously potent however, like on the order of one or two buttons would thoroughly penetrate. Of course, yield was abysmal with the buttons, sometimes whole trays would go and others one jar would go in a tray of 24. You can do it dest! Thats why i decided to post the pics, maybe inspire a new generation! After all, i was only 23 when i was doing this lol! The sterile work is straightforward and will come to you but is impossible without a flow hood. So do what i did and build one out of plexi and hepa filters. Save quite a few bucks there, and you don't need to do a liquid inoculation, rye grain starter would work although increase of labour and contamination points. The magnetic stirrers for liquid are expensive but you can also make your own like I did as well.

Anyhoo, I did actually grow out a number of strains. I'd have to dig through my notes somewhere from the period but i did around 10 strains total, from mexican landrace kind of stuff through to the b+ kind of stuff. I played around with hybridizing but ultimately I ended up 'cloning' the highest yielding batches and these pics are all of the final production strain. There was quite a bit of variation in potency, yield and general morphology amongst the strains. I selected for yield and purpling when bruised and in some of the pics you can see alot of colour.
